Filing taxes accurately is a cornerstone of business compliance, but mistakes happen. Whether it is a misspelled name, an incorrect Social Security Number (SSN), or an error in reported wages, correcting a Form W-2 can be a stressful process. Form W-2c (Corrected Wage and Tax Statement) is the IRS requirement for fixing these mistakes.

Correcting tax forms does not have to be a convoluted process. Here is how ezW2Correction simplifies the workflow: Step 1: Set Up Company Information
Enter your business details, including your Employer Identification Number (EIN), company name, and address. This information automatically populates onto the transmittal Form W-3c. Step 2: Input Employee and Correction Data
Select the tax year you need to amend. Enter the employee’s identifying information and fill in the “Previously Reported” and “Correct Information” columns for the specific boxes that contain errors. Step 3: Review and Validate
The software automatically calculates the differences between your original and corrected amounts, reducing manual math errors. Review the on-screen form to ensure the changes accurately reflect your payroll adjustments. Step 4: Print or E-File
Choose your output method. You can print Copy A for the SSA, Copy B and C for the employee, and Copy D for your own corporate records. If you prefer to e-file, upload the generated electronic file directly to the SSA’s Business Services Online (BSO) portal. Why Choose ezW2Correction Over Manual Filing?
